How cleaning improves indoor air quality

Dust, pollen and pet dander — what they do

These common pollutants settle into carpets, soft furnishings and around skirting boards, then become airborne again with everyday activity. Once airborne, they trigger irritation and can aggravate asthma and allergies.

Removing them at the source — not just moving them around — is crucial. Effective removal includes targeted dusting, high-filtration vacuuming and cleaning hidden areas where particles accumulate.

Ventilation and mould prevention

Cleaning and ventilation work together. Regular removal of damp residues and surface grime prevents the conditions that encourage mould.

Simple measures such as short periods of airing and using extractor fans in kitchens and bathrooms, combined with cleaning, reduce musty odours and lower spore counts. Where condensation or leaks occur, prompt cleaning and drying stop small problems becoming larger ones.

Cleaner surfaces mean fewer germs

Daily maintenance of high-contact areas (door handles, light switches, worktops) reduces bacterial and viral transfer and helps limit illness spread within the household.

Keeping these surfaces clean makes hygiene easier during cold and flu seasons and supports the wellbeing of vulnerable residents. Regular cleaning doesn’t remove all risk, but it significantly lowers the chances of spread across family members and visitors.

Products and practices that protect health

Choosing the right tools and products is important for reducing airborne irritants and chemical residues. We recommend and use:

  • Microfibre cloths to trap dust rather than spreading it
  • High-filtration vacuum cleaners to reduce particle re-release
  • Eco-conscious cleaners with low volatile compounds and minimal artificial fragrances where possible
  • Targeted mould treatments and thorough drying to prevent recurrence
